OMV and REPSOL to study potential of hydrocarbon reserves on Georgian shelf in the Black Sea

The Energy Minister Kakha Kaladze, vice president of the Austrian oil and gas company OMV, Walter Hamilton and director of the Spanish oil and gas company REPSOL’s Department for Europe and Central East, Michele Erquiaga Agirov have signed a memorandum of cooperation. The signing took place during the visit of the head of the Austrian Foreign Ministry to Georgia.

The purpose of the memorandum is evaluation and study of potential of hydrocarbon reserves on the Black Sea shelf of Georgia.
